2. Tilda


Tilda has a gorgeous user interface and an intuitive and versatile way to build websites where you can drag and drop pre-built blocks to build your own site.

550 highly customizable blocks include full-screen images, photo galleries, background videos, contact forms, and more.


Pricing : starts at $10 /month

Free option available

What to consider when choosing an Nocode website builder?

There are a few reasons why we'd recommend a no-code app:

  1. Ease of Use - Based on how easily an app allows for non-technical users to take advantage of it.
  2. Flexibility - How much flexibility does this tool have with respect to what you can build? Does it allow handling complex decisions and allow you to bring to life any idea you present without worrying about coding at all?
  3. Freedom with Design - Does the tool offer freedom in order to gain full design? Not all No-Code tools provide complete freedom. If you're inexperienced in your ability to design, it would be better to choose a tool with less design freedom, as these will often set beautiful defaults for you.
  4. Simply, how affordable is this tool? These tools often begin with a free trial, but may require you to publish your app live. Other tools have limitations, such as the amount of records in your database and not being able to integrate other tools into your app without additional costs. As long as you can afford it, go ahead and choose a tool that accommodates your requirements.
